
In a world-first initiative, the UAE Council for Fatwa will use AI-driven drones to observe the crescent moon, marking the start of Ramadan. This innovative approach highlights the UAE’s commitment to integrating cutting-edge technology into traditional practices.
According to the Council, AI-powered drones will enhance the direct visual observation method, which remains central to confirming the Ramadan crescent in accordance with Islamic teachings. The drones will work alongside naked-eye sightings and advanced astronomical observatories, ensuring greater precision in determining the holy month’s beginning.
This initiative is being implemented in collaboration with national institutions, specialized research centers, and observatories equipped with state-of-the-art technology.
